Rosenhaus cryptic about 80, 17

Posted by Mike Garafolo June 13, 2008 1:34PM
Categories: Minicamp

Drew Rosenhaus was in Arizona on Tuesday, Chicago on Wednesday, Cincinnati yesterday and East Rutherford today. (Look out New England! Here he comes!)

After chatting with Plaxico Burress in his car and Sinorice Moss outside of his ride, Rosenhaus took a few minutes to chat with a few reporters.

"I'm just here to visit with my clients as they wrap up minicamp, to see the guys," Rosenhaus said. "That was my purpose for being here."

Not likely.

Here's the rest of Drew's brief session with the media.

(By Burress standing on the sideline, are you trying to antagonize the Giants?)
We're not trying to antagonize the Giants. I think everyone knows Plax has been battling an ankle injury. He didn't practice most of last year because of the ankle and it was just a carryover. The bottom line is I'm very confident Plax will be healthy and ready to go for the start of the season.

(He said he was healthy enough to practice but that he wasn't participating because of his contract situation.)
I'm going to steer away from that. I think the focus should be we are in discussions with the team, Plaxico was here. I think we're headed in the right direction. I'd rather not get into anything that might be negative.

(Are you confident Jeremy will be able to smooth things over and stay here?)
A lot of people ask me about Jeremy. In his comments last week, he said he takes a great deal of pride in the fact that everything pertaining to him he's kept between himself and the Giants, so really I have to follow his lead. He's my client and I respect his position, so all of the discussions we have with the Giants I'm going to keep him that way.

(People don't realize what a sensitive guy he can be. Is it beyond the point where his feelings can be mended?)
It's an issue that we're working on, that we're talking to the team with. We're just going to have to take it one day at a time.

(Do you think Shockey wants to remain with the Giants?)
I don't specifically have a way to address that at this time because Jeremy's been very adamant about avoiding any public discussion about a situation. The best thing I can say about Jeremy's situation is that we are talking to the team about some of the issues that exist and we hope to get that resolved.

(Do you want everything resolved before training camp?)
You always do. As an agent and a player, you always hope to get things resolved as soon as possible. This minicamp, there was a lot of attention we hope will not be there when training camp rolls around.

(So in your mind Shockey and Burress will have things in tow before training camp with no acrimony?)
I hope we've got nothing to talk about, but let me just say either way I hope we've got nothing to talk about as it relates to my clients on this team - that Kenny Phillips is signed before camp and that Jeremy's situation is resolved, whatever that may be and obviously Plaxico having a new contract.

(Do you think Plax will be fined for not participating in practice this week?)
I hope not. The bottom line is he shouldn't be. He does have an ankle (injury) and he's been in treatment all minicamp. I think he's gone about things professionally and he's been in communication with his coaches and he's here. We want to dwell on the positives.

(How long are you in town?)
Just today. Thank you.

And with that, he was gone - like Batman into the shadows. And he said if we need him again, all we have to do is shine the Rosenhaus Sports logo into the sky.

a quote from Plax on Wednesday


“Me and my agent are trying to get this deal done for the future so I can remain a New York Giant, and we’re just not happy with the way things are going right now. That’s basically the main reason why I’m not out there. … I personally don’t like the way that it’s going,” he told the media on Wednesday.

It is quite obvious that Rosenhaus is more than a little involved here; anyone think him showing up at the stadium "to talk to his clients" was a co-incidence?
